Output d73f153a5520579e159e2114bf9cdc73ea83ea5cf9e2820d3cd39a95dfed4e05:2

value
904155
script pubkey
OP_0 OP_PUSHBYTES_20 af8db7dc56cd9917374849938ab2552bc8ea1b75
address
bc1q47xm0hzkekv3wd6gfxfc4vj490yw5xm4z7egvp
transaction
d73f153a5520579e159e2114bf9cdc73ea83ea5cf9e2820d3cd39a95dfed4e05
spent
true